Transaction 20486593d06f714e16c7342e8ed4deb9624b6d9306e9ccf714e8b95bb0937dc3

1 Input
2 Outputs
  • 20486593d06f714e16c7342e8ed4deb9624b6d9306e9ccf714e8b95bb0937dc3:0
  • value  62820100
    address  15zzYxcJVuJn4TerEyoXLcRMe1MFaU8Bwc
  • 20486593d06f714e16c7342e8ed4deb9624b6d9306e9ccf714e8b95bb0937dc3:1
  • value  12000000
    address  36PznzjrETucDoXocXnNvsa2MJvHacw3eG